Abstract

L'invention concerne o un revêtement de dispositif de mise en forme de produits en verre comprenant - une première phase quasicristalline ou approximante ou amorphe métallique, et - une seconde phase constituée d'un alliage eutectique de point de fusion compris entre 950 et 1150°C et de dureté nominale comprise entre 30 et 65 HRc ; ○ un moule de fabrication de produits en verre creux muni de ce revêtement ; o un outillage de mise en forme de verre en feuille ou en plaque muni de ce revêtement ; o un matériau constituant ce revêtement ; o une poudre pré-mélangée ou pré-alliée, ou un cordon souple ou fil formé permettant d'obtenir ce revêtement ; o un procédé de projection thermique pour l'obtention de ce revêtement.
